The advantages of a passive filter are that it is quite simple to design and implement. This leads to the reception of the comparatively low signal at the output of the filter circuit than the applied input signal. Additionally … They can handle large voltage currents and power, There is no limitation on the frequency range, They do not need the additional dc power supply for their operation, There is no isolation between input and output, The circuit becomes bulky if inductors are used, There is always some loss of signal it can be in the passband, There is no clear demarcation between passband and stopband but actually, it gets mixed up. Active filters contain amplifying devices to increase signal strength while passive do not contain amplifying devices to strengthen the signal. These filters are more responsible than passive filters; No resonance issue; It can eliminate any harmonics; Used for voltage regulation; Used for reactive power compensation; It provides reliable operation; It can be designed to provide some passband gain; No loading problem; Active filter using OP-AMP does not load the input load As no amplifying element is present in it thus passive filters offer low signal gain.
